60-year-old woman charged with assaulting Milford woman

A Milford woman was charged with punching and hitting a 23-year-old woman with a desk fan earlier this month, police said Tuesday.

Police arrested 60-year-old Rose L. Deshields, also known as Rosa L. Person, after investigation revealed she got into a verbal dispute with a 23-year-old at a Brightway Commons Apartment Complex residence near Milford that quickly escalated, Detective Dwight Young said.

During the argument, Deshields punched the woman in the head multiple times before grabbing a 12-inch oscillating desk fan and continuing to hit the woman with it as witnesses tried to separate the two women, Young said.

When the woman was able to flee from Deshields into another room, the woman threatened her and said she was going to kill her, Young said.

The victim had minor injuries to her arms and legs but refused medical treatment, Young said. A 1-year-old child was also present during the assault but was not injured, he added.

Deshields was charged with aggravated menacing, third degree assault, terroristic threatening, endangering the welfare of a child and criminal mischief. She was released on $17,550 unsecured bond.
